News of tournaments, strange petals floating down river, and a rare excursion by the Siren's Song, thought by many previously to be unseaworthy did not escape Shalukhe Silverhand, once of the Moonshae. But these things did not preoccupy the self professed puzzle solver. No she had bigger stew to share. A chef had gone missing and rabbit stew was off the menu. She was spotted calling on one Sergeant Peters of the Flaming Fist who has been put in charge of the investigation.

As part of the ongoing Midsummer Fair, there will be a Tournament held in the Northern Farmlands Arena on the 1st at ((20:30 GMT)).
This Tournament is sponsored by the Church of Tymora and presented by the Bladestone Foundation. There is no entry fee but there will be a grand prize of 50,000 gold provided. Other prizes may or may not be forthcoming for higher-placing participants.
Rules for the tournament:
Double elimination (you have to lose twice)
6 wards allowed per fight.
Shapeshift, Bardic inspiration, and Stealth (unlimited use) all count as 1 ward of the 6.
Please don't shapeshift and use Enlarge, we only have so much space.
No healing, mundane or magical, other than your equipment.
Wards that run out may be refreshed during the fight as long as they are the same ward.
No offensive magics, this is for weapon fighting. And this way none of the spectators get blown up.
No summoning, this is YOUR fight
This is a melee fighting tournament. Use fists, sticks, or steel please.
Don't leave the combat square, or be disqualified.
There will likely be refreshment tents set up for you to partake food and drink from

Hear Ye, Hear Ye!
Let it be known that the Midsummer Faire sponsored by the Tymora Church came to a close with a small tournament in the Northern Farmlands officiated by the Bladestone Foundation. The three participants were:
Doan Mardain, a good dwarf to have in a pinch
Hans Pebbleskip, the irrepressible dancing dwarf
Bael'thar, who's got a really big sword
The double elimination tournament ended with Doan taking first place, followed by Bael, and then Hans. This is not to say, however, that it was an easy win or placement for any of them Many of the matches were close, some razor-thin close, much to the delight of spectators.
All participants showed good manners, good attitudes, honorable actions, and great skill. Doan was awarded 50,000 coin from the Tymora Church for first place.
Bael received a purse of 25,000 from the Bladestone Foundation, and Hans received 10,000 from the Bladestone.
All Hail the valiant fighters!

A peculiar duo wandered into the Eastern Farmlands today: A redheaded human girl, and a grey-skinned blonde tiefling with large horns and dark mithral armor. The tiefling seemed to struggle in the daylight, and had to be led half-blind into the Blade and Stars inn by her companion.
The whole time, they both seemed thoroughly out of their element, with the human remaining in constant awe and good spirits until they retired to a room at the inn.

Chaos ensued yesterday, when a member of the City Watch attempted to arrest the tiefling - no longer in her armor - for displaying an axe just short of Wyrm's Crossing. Before their arrest, the redhead tried to talk her friend down, only to find herself caught in a three-way brawl as she struggled to make sure no one got hurt.DaloLorn wrote: ↑Wed Aug 04, 2021 3:32 pm A peculiar duo wandered into the Eastern Farmlands today: A redheaded human girl, and a grey-skinned blonde tiefling with large horns and dark mithral armor. The tiefling seemed to struggle in the daylight, and had to be led half-blind into the Blade and Stars inn by her companion.
The whole time, they both seemed thoroughly out of their element, with the human remaining in constant awe and good spirits until they retired to a room at the inn.
The duo appeared to have been released some time afterwards, with the tiefling's personality becoming noticeably more restrained, cautious, and even submissive at times. Visitors to the Ilmatari temple might have subsequently overheard them talking to an assortment of knights, priests, and monks of Candlekeep about split personalities, memory loss, and wandering out of the Underdark with no idea where they were anymore. A peculiar story, indeed.
After leaving the temple, the tiefling inquired around the Farmlands for the location of a brothel, justifying it to the flustered redhead with a remark about their having the best baths. However, after a brief negotiation with Blunt, the duo instead wandered east along the Chionthar. When they returned much later in the day, they did so in a staggered, uncoordinated manner, with their hair still waterlogged after whatever adventures they embarked upon. Given that their clothes were nowhere near as wet as they were, one could surmise that the strange newcomers were somehow able to take care of their bathing problem at some point during their travels.
The human returned to the city first; when the tiefling came back, she was accompanied by a second tiefling, a reddish-hued man in fancier - and drier - clothing. Ultimately, both women eventually returned to their room at the Blade and Stars.

Fliers pop up throughout the city.
I, Heartwarder Alyssia Leonhart, High Lady of the Halls of Inner Light, invite those of curious minds and wandering hearts of the Gate and the Sword Coast to come to a educational litany on the Dogma of the Princess of Passion. It will be a deep dive into the faith and duties of Sunites, what Lady Firehair asks of us, and what we can provide to the city though our faith and dedication to Lady Firehair. All those welcome within the city may come to the Halls of Inner Light Prayer Hall and become educated on the finer points of the Sunite Faith. It will be held on the 21st of Eleasis, 1357 in the afternoon.
Afterwords, food and drink will be served in the Heartfire Tavern and questions about the service will be fielded to answer any questions about the faith.
I look forward to seeing you there,
Heartwarder Alyssia Leonhart
High Lady of the Halls of Inner Light

Activity at the Radiant Heart Charterhouse
At the Radiant House charter house an Emerald Scout could be seen making his way in the Side Gate nodding to the Paladin on Watch at the courtyard. He carried with him several field sketched maps in their perspective map cases.
The forge’s smokestack was bellowing out a steady dark grey plumes or smoke from the preparations to weapons, equipment and support equipments. In the horse pen a Squire tended to the horseshoes of the warhorses and the pack horses. In the courtyard several field tents had been set up to air out and to make sure they where in good working conditions.
He made his way into the keep and headed bellow to speak with the Blacksmith putting an order for a few crates of razor tipped broad-heads for his arrows.
